How much do part time ai evaluator j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time ai evaluator in the United States is $65,471.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$44,500.00 and $79,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a part time AI evaluator typically collaborate with other team members, and what communication tools are most commonly used?

Part Time AI Evaluators frequently work remotely and collaborate with project managers, data scientists, and fellow evaluators. Communication and feedback are usually handled through online platforms such as Slack, Microsoft Teams, or proprietary portals. Regular check-ins, virtual meetings, and shared documentation help ensure alignment on project guidelines and expectations. Clear communication is key, as evaluators often provide detailed feedback on AI outputs and contribute to continuous system improvement.

What is the difference between Part Time Ai Evaluator vs Part Time Data Annotator?

AspectPart Time Ai EvaluatorPart Time Data Annotator
CredentialsBasic computer skills, attention to detailBasic computer skills, attention to detail
Work EnvironmentRemote, flexible hoursRemote, flexible hours
Industry UsageAI companies, tech firmsAI, machine learning, data companies
Job FocusEvaluating AI outputs, quality controlLabeling and annotating data for training

Both roles are remote, entry-level positions in the AI industry requiring similar skills. The main difference is that Part Time Ai Evaluators focus on assessing AI-generated content for accuracy, while Part Time Data Annotators are responsible for labeling data to train AI models.

What is a part time AI evaluator?

Part Time AI Evaluators are individuals who work on a flexible, often remote basis to assess, review, and provide feedback on artificial intelligence outputs, such as search engine results, chatbot responses, or image recognition results. Their evaluations help improve the accuracy and quality of AI systems by ensuring outputs are relevant and appropriate according to set guidelines. These roles typically require attention to detail, analytical skills, and familiarity with online platforms. Hours are usually flexible, making it a popular option for those seeking supplemental income or remote work exper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time AI evaluator, and why are they important?

To excel as a Part Time AI Evaluator,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in written communication, typically supported by a high school diploma or higher. Familiarity with online evaluation platforms, basic computer literacy, and sometimes knowledge of specific annotation tools are commonly required. Adaptability, reliability, and the ability to follow detailed guidelines help individuals stand out in this role. These skills ensure consistent, high-quality feedback that supports the development and improvement of AI systems.
